react 子传参父_react子父传参有几种方法?
生活随笔
收集整理的這篇文章主要介紹了
react 子传参父_react子父传参有几种方法?
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
react子父傳參有幾種方法?下面本篇文章給大家介紹一下react父子組件傳參(值)的方法。有一定的參考價值,有需要的朋友可以參考一下,希望對大家有所幫助。
react父子組件傳參(值)的幾種方法
一、父組件傳給子組件
父組件通過props傳遞給子組件;//父組件中
//子組件中
console.log(this.props.data);
二、子組件傳給父組件
父組件通過props向子組件傳入一個方法,子組件在通過調用該方法,將數據以參數的形式傳給父組件,父組件可以在該方法中對傳入的數據進行處理;//父組件
import Child from './Child.js';
export default class Parent extend compenent{
getData=(data)=>{
console.log(data);
}
render(){
return (
父組件
)
}
}//子組件
export default class Child extend compenent{
state={
data:[1,2,3]
}
render(){
const {data}=this.state;
return (
子組件
{this.props.getData(data)}}>
)
}
}
更多react的相關知識,可訪問:前端開發學習!!
總結
以上是生活随笔為你收集整理的react 子传参父_react子父传参有几种方法?的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: php excel 垂直居中,完美实现文
- 下一篇: mysql选取最小值_MySQL:选择x